Severe Weather Warning Heavy Rain seiten=3 abk=warning

For the following areas
- Strathclyde
- Dumfries + Galloway
- Perth + Kinross
- Stirling

Issued by the Met Office at 22:45 on Saturday, 12th January 2008
Valid from 00:35 on Sunday, 13th January 2008 until 15:00 on Sunday, 13th January 2008

Rain will become prolonged and heavy during Sunday with 25mm falling widely, but with 50 to 60mm possible over some hilly areas in Dumfries and Galloway, Argyll and western parts of Stirling and Perth & Kinross. North of the Central Lowlands significant snow is expected for a time overnight, but as it turns to rain, thawing snow will increase the risk of localised flooding. The public are advised to take extra care and refer to 'Traffic Scotland' for further advice on road conditions, and to the latest Scottish Environment Protection Agency 'Live Flood Warning Information'.
